在Excel中,我可以执行以下操作:
ActiveWorkbook.Styles("Normal").Font.Name = "Calibri"
这复制了导航到Home功能区并选择将使用的特定字体的操作,以避免在几十个地方以编程方式分配不同的字体。
PowerPoint中是否有相同的内容?
ActivePresentation.Styles
会返回错误。
我使用对象浏览器并搜索Style
(希望找到明显/直观的东西),但有几十个结果,它们都没有特别有希望。希望其他人在此之前参与其中。
答案 0 :(得分:0)
通过一些试验和错误,这似乎可以解决问题:
With ActivePresentation
.SlideMaster.Theme.ThemeFontScheme.MinorFont.Item(1).Name = "Calibri"
End With
还有一个.MajorFont
但看起来.MinorFont
就是我需要的。